The pause spikes in MatchForge trace back to the arena allocator promoting short-lived candidate objects into the old generation during burst matching. I've tuned the collector to favor shorter young-gen cycles, which cut p99 pauses from 180ms to 40ms in the Harlowe staging cluster. Please don't change these without rerunning the burst benchmark. The constants I landed on are listed below.

tuning table, yajog-yahof:
BUDGETS = {
    "lamvan": 303,
    "wenox": 460,
    "fenvan": 525,
}

### Runbook: BounceBroom — Account Recovery

If the BounceBroom email bounce processor loses access to its service account, do not create a new one. First, pause the intake queue so bounces buffer safely. Then open the recovery console and select the BounceBroom principal. Verification requires approval from the on-call lead. Once approved, the console prompts for the stored recovery credentials; enter the passphrase that appears directly below this paragraph.

recovery phrase for fahof-kahap: holion-gormir-jorix-istix-briwyn-sorael

Handover for the night shift at the Dunmere Annex, our temporary site during the Hartfield Row renovation. Rounds are the same as before, but the annex has no rear patrol route — check the car park from the front windows instead. Contractors may still be on site until 22:00; sign them out as usual. The annex side entrance uses the code below.

turnstile pass: bdg-FVNQRS-72965873